html和css " />
HTML(超文本标记语言)是一种用于创建网页和其他信息在Web浏览器中展示的标记语言。HTML提供了很多标签来描述文档的结构和内容,使得文档能在不同的设备和浏览器上呈现出相同的效果。其中,一些标签具有name属性,用于定义元素的名称或标识。在本文中,我们将介绍HTML中有name属性的标签,并以西安旅游网站为例说明在HTML和CSS中如何使用它们。
HTML中有name属性的标签
1. input标签
input标签用于创建表单中的输入字段。它可以是文本框、单选框、复选框、密码框、文件选择框等等。当input标签用于创建单选框和复选框时,name属性用于将多个选项分组,以便在提交表单时进行区分。例如:
```
```
在上面的例子中,name属性值为“gender”的两个单选框分别代表性别的不同选项,使用相同的name属性分组,以便在提交表单时可以区分。
2. textarea标签
textarea标签用于创建多行文本输入框。与单行文本框不同,它可以用于输入较长的文本,比如评论、留言等。与input标签一样,textarea标签也有name属性,用于标识该输入框的名称。例如:
```
```
在上面的例子中,name属性值为“comments”的textarea标签是评论输入框,当用户在该输入框中输入评论时,表单会将其值发送到服务器以便进行处理。
3. select和option标签
select和option标签用于创建选择框,可以让用户从预定义的选项列表中选择一个或多个选项。select标签有name属性,用于将所有选项分组。option标签有value属性用于指定选项的值。例如:
```
```
在上面的例子中,name属性值为“city”的select标签是城市选择框,当用户在该选择框中选择城市时,表单会将选中的选项值发送到服务器以便进行处理。
4. a标签
a标签用于创建超链接,可以引导用户到其他Web页或其他地方。它有href属性指定链接的目标地址。另外,它也有name属性,用于将链接分组或命名。例如:
```
```
在上面的例子中,name属性值为“logo”的a标签是网站首页的链接。当用户单击该链接时,浏览器会跳转到指定的目标地址。
在上面的例子中,name属性值为“logo”的a标签是网站首页的链接。当用户单击该链接时,浏览器会跳转到指定的目标地址。
CSS中如何使用标签的name属性?
CSS(层叠样式表)是一种用于控制文档展示的样式表语言,可以为HTML和XML文档的布局、字体、颜色、背景等提供样式。在CSS中,可以使用属性选择器来选择带有特定name属性的元素,从而为这些元素应用样式。
例如,以下CSS将设置name属性值为“logo”的a标签字体的颜色为蓝色:
```
a[name="logo"] {
color: blue;
}
```
在这个例子中,属性选择器[name="logo"]通过指定属性名和属性值,选中了所有name属性值为“logo”的a标签,然后对其应用了color属性。
类似地,可以通过属性选择器来选择带有其他name属性的元素并为它们应用样式。
总结
HTML提供了很多标签来描述文档结构和内容,并为一些标签提供了name属性,用于标识或分组元素。在CSS中,可以使用属性选择器来选择带有特定name属性的元素并为它们应用样式。在实际开发中,熟练掌握这些标签和属性选择器,有助于提高Web开发的效率和质量。
壹涵网络我们是一家专注于网站建设、企业营销、网站关键词排名、AI内容生成、新媒体营销和短视频营销等业务的公司。我们拥有一支优秀的团队,专门致力于为客户提供优质的服务。
我们致力于为客户提供一站式的互联网营销服务,帮助客户在激烈的市场竞争中获得更大的优势和发展机会!
发表评论 取消回复